CMAA duty ratings range from A through F with "A" being the lightest and "F" the heaviest. The ratings apply to bridge cranes only and not hoists alone. The CMAA rating is often confused with the HMI or ASME hoist duty ratings summarized elsewhere in this web. The CMAA classifications are generally described as set forth below.

Class C Moderate Service In terms of numbers most cranes are built to meet Class C service requirements. This service covers cranes that may be used in machine shops or paper mill machine rooms. In this type of service the crane will handle loads that average 50 of the rated capacity with 5 to 10 lifts per hour averaging 15 feet.

CMAA is the Crane Manufacturers Association of America Inc. an independent trade association affiliated with the Material Handling Industry. CMAA traces its roots to the Electric Overhead Crane Institute known as EOCI which was founded in 1927 by leading crane manufacturers of that time to promote the standardization of cranes as well as uniform quality and performance.

Please note that the duty classification of a crane has nothing to do with the capacity of the crane. When we build a Class B 10 ton overhead crane it is an entirely different set of components than when we build a Class E 10 ton overhead crane. In general the class E crane is going to have heavier duty rated motors end trucks and more steel
